Two more Black Skull supplements arrive at Bodybuilding.com

More Black Skull supplements have shown up in the US this month, following on from the three Combat Series products the Brazilian brand dropped at the end of November. Now available from Black Skull’s major retailer Bodybuilding.com are its two very basic weight loss formulas, the Eduardo Correa Series M.F. Booster and Carol Saraiva Series SexyBony.

If you’re not familiar with Black Skull’s line, despite the two fat burners sounding quite complex they are just individual ingredient formulas. Both M.F. Booster and SexyBony are in fact identical, only featuring half a gram of l-carnitine in each of their 60 servings. Not too surprisingly, Bodybuilding.com has priced the two new supplements exactly the same at $17.49 a piece.
